The video tutorial guides viewers through solving a word problem using a pie chart. It involves understanding the problem, calculating the number of women, determining the ratio of women to girls, finding the number of boys, and verifying the results. The process is broken down into steps: understanding the problem, devising a plan, carrying out the plan, and checking the results.
